Youngstown native Philip Taylor Kramer had success first as the bassist for the 1970s rock band Iron Butterfly, and then as a math and science prodigy working on government nuclear projects and then his own inventions. When he disappeared in 1995 from his California community, those who knew him were torn between whether he was a suicide risk, or had been abducted by people after his life's work.
